Method of detecting defaults on both sides of each parent metal/filler metal interface formed by the welding of a first metallic piece (1) on another metallic piece (2), in particular of T-shaped welded joints made of steel with an austenitic structure, comprising the emission of longitudinal ultrasonic waves (40) on the wall or surface of one of the said pieces, towards the interface (4, 6) to be checked, the detection of the echo return and the use of samples comprising discontinuities at predetermined locations for the evaluation of the echoes, characterized in that the echo return is detected substantially at the point of emission (PE) of the longitudinal ultrasonic waves (40), an echo return is compared with a pre-established reference echo with the aid of a standard joint (17, 18, 20) corresponding to the joint to be checked and comprising predetermined standard holes (22, 24, 26, 28, 30) near the said interface and useful for the production of reference echoes different from the echoes produced by the interface and in that the echo return is detected only during the lapse of time determined by the reference echo.</p> |
